Summary

Our client is seeking to add a full-time Cook to the team at Mok Lee Chinese Restaurant in Redwood Park. Serving the local community since 2021, the restaurant offers authentic Chinese flavours and is seeking an applicant with an AQF Certificate IV and at least one year of relevant experience.

The role reports to the Head Chef.

The typical job responsibilities will include, but are not limited to the following:

- Prepare and maintain house sauces including black bean, Mongolian, satay, sweet and sour and honey sauces ready for service.
- Carry out stir-frying, deep-frying, braising and steaming techniques in the correct sequence and timing to maintain dish quality.
- Maintain a clean and organised workstation, ensuring utensils and ingredients are properly arranged during service.
- Examine incoming ingredients including meat, seafood, vegetables and spices to ensure freshness and quality standards before preparation.
- Regulate and monitor temperatures of gas stoves, ovens, deep fryers and other cooking equipment throughout service.
- Portion cooked food onto plates or takeaway containers and add appropriate sauces, gravies and garnishes.
- Store prepared ingredients and cooked food in temperature-controlled fridges, freezers and storage areas following food safety requirements.
- Prepare and cook Chinese and Asian dishes according to the restaurant’s recipes, including fried rice, noodles,



braised meats and battered items.
- Season dishes during the cooking process to achieve the correct flavour balance and consistency.
- Prepare and modify dishes to meet special dietary requests such as gluten-free, mild spice, vegetarian or allergen-free options.
- Estimate daily ingredient quantities based on takeaway and delivery orders to minimise waste and shortages.
- Instruct and support kitchen hands and new staff on preparation methods, cooking procedures and hygiene standards.
